B4204T7 motorral szerelt járművek listája:
Mely autókban található a B4204T7 motor, és milyen motorolajat érdemes használni hozzá? A B4204T7 motor gyakori hibái, tünetei, diagnosztikája, megelőzése és javítása.
- VOLVO - S60 T5 (177kW) 2010–2013
- VOLVO - V70 T5 (177kW) 2010–2013
- VOLVO - S80 T5 (177kW) 2010–2013
- VOLVO - XC60 T5 (177kW) 2010–2015
- VOLVO - V60 T5 (177kW) 2010–2013

Engine B4204T7
Symptoms:
- Rough idling and engine misfires
- Loss of power or hesitation during acceleration
- Check Engine Light (CEL) illumination
- Increased oil consumption or oil leaks
- Unusual noises such as ticking or knocking from the engine bay
Diagnosis:
- Inspect ignition coils and spark plugs for wear or damage, as these are common failure points causing misfires.
- Perform a diagnostic scan to check for fault codes related to the turbocharger, fuel system, or emissions components.
- Check for vacuum leaks or intake manifold gasket leaks which can cause rough running.
- Inspect the turbocharger for signs of oil leakage or shaft play.
- Examine the PCV (Positive Crankcase Ventilation) system for clogging or malfunction.
- Verify the condition of the timing chain and tensioner, as premature wear can cause noise and performance issues.
Fixes:
- Replace faulty ignition coils and worn spark plugs to restore smooth engine operation.
- Repair or replace leaking intake manifold gaskets or vacuum hoses to eliminate rough idling.
- Service or replace the turbocharger if oil leaks or mechanical faults are detected.
- Clean or replace the PCV valve to prevent pressure buildup and oil leaks.
- Replace timing chain components if wear or slack is found to prevent engine damage.
- Address oil leaks by replacing seals or gaskets as needed.
Prevention:
- Follow the manufacturer’s recommended maintenance schedule, including timely oil and filter changes using high-quality synthetic oil.
- Use OEM or high-quality replacement parts for ignition and fuel system components.
- Regularly inspect and maintain the PCV system to avoid pressure-related issues.
- Avoid prolonged idling and aggressive driving to reduce stress on the turbocharger and engine components.
- Monitor engine performance and address warning signs early to prevent more severe damage.
